Campsite: Cedar River Campground

When we called to reserve a site we asked for two things, full hook up and be able to get satellite (Direct TV). The person was very nice on the phone stating she had a site for us. We backed into site which was tight but do-able. My husband plugged in our power surge protector and it showed issues. The owners weren't there but she did call back, gave us a few choices of other sites which we didn't fit. She even had someone (I assume CG Host) drive my husband around looking at other possible sites. None would work for our rig. We were disappointed but had no choice to look else where. We asked for refund and were told according to the cancellation policy nothing would be due. She did say she'd tell them it was an emergency and would see if they (who "they" are I don't know, possibly management company) would do anything but it's been 2 days and have heard nothing. It wasn't like we said "changed our minds, we don't want to stay here". We had no choice!

Campsite: Indian Heritage RV Park

Came here for the race and loved it. Michele was great to work with, we were close enough to the track that I walked there. I would have loved to stay longer just to visit other parts of the area.

October 2022 - so we came back and scheduled our stay longer than just the race weekend so we were able to visit a few places and see more of Martinsville. We went to Eggleston Falls then a hiking trail close by then Fall Creek. Both pretty close. Thank you again for another great visit here Michele. We very much appreciate your hospitality!!!

Campsite: Chief Logan State Park

We were staying in Man, WV and any trails in that area were ATV trails, was so thrilled to find the wonderful SP. Miles of hiking trails and for the most part well marked and maintained. I hike with my dog and she's done great on them as well. By the time we leave it will have been 10 days in this area and without this park I would have been bored. I will say West Virginia is a beautiful state and will visit again.
